The Mall of Berlin

18-Jul-2025 • Berlin Germany

The Mall of Berlin was new for us. It wasn't built yet back in 2012 during our first visit. The mall was quite big and on its premises were two buildings facing each other. We went inside both. One side was full of stores and restaurants while the other was only half occupied. We came here a number of times to eat at the food court. The restaurants served food from Asia, the Middle East not to mention the usual American food chains like KFC and McDonalds. On one occasion, I ordered Persian food here. It was my very first time to eat food from Iran. It was chicken in mango sauce served with a big plate of white rice. That night, Marc had Indian food. The food was good. We try as much as possible to try new dishes when we travel but we eat in McDonald's and KFC too when we feel like it.
